Perhaps you work in a multi CAD platform office or work with contractors or suppliers that use another CAD system like MicroStation V8. AutoCAD 2008 adds the ability to import, export, and even reference as an underlay the V8 format DGN file content/geometry.
The underlay option is a nice way to not convert or modify the V8 DGN file but base your design in AutoCAD DWG on the referenced DGN geometry. I created a short 2 minute video during the alpha and beta of AutoCAD 2008 then codename Spago and am posting it for your viewing.

Can AutoCAD 2008 open .DGN extension files for viewing and printing regions of a given drawing?
Regards, Dimitris Kokoulas Electrical Engineer
Dimitris,
You can insert the DGN as an underlay in a new drawing then plot the view or plot the region of the drawing you want.
